Wiktionary
GLYCERIDE, noun. (organic chemistry) An ester of glycerol and one or more fatty acid; they are the major constituents of lipids.
Dictionary definition
GLYCERIDE, noun. An ester of glycerol and fatty acids that occurs naturally as fats and fatty oils; "fresh fats contain glycerides of fatty acids and very little free acid".
